This paper explores a Cloud computing-based concept for Intelligent Transportation Systems (ITS) aimed at enhancing traffic flow management and safety. It presents the development of an off-board control system that leverages existing wireless communication technologies and a modular architecture to improve data collection and processing. The proposed system promises scalability and robustness, allowing for gradual implementation in urban environments, ultimately facilitating better traffic management through advanced data analytics.
